Unlocking Scale as a CEO is a 1h 28m online intermediate-level course on Udemy by Greg Coticchia that covers business & management. This course delivers practical insights for CEOs aiming to transition from growth to scale. The content blends mindset, people strategy, and financial literacy effectively. While concise, it offers actionable frameworks for real-world application. Some learners may wish for deeper financial modeling or case studies. We rate it 8.1/10.

Standout Strengths
Mindset Clarity: Clearly defines the psychological shift from operator to leader. Helps CEOs reframe identity and decision-making at scale.
People Strategy: Emphasizes cultural fit and role alignment. Offers practical guidance on placing talent where they thrive most.
Financial Literacy: Breaks down essential KPIs without jargon. Enables CEOs to engage confidently with financial reports and forecasts.
Scaling Mechanics: Distinguishes lifestyle, growth, and scaling models. Helps leaders identify their current stage and next steps.
Funding Awareness: Surveys common funding paths with balanced pros and cons. Prepares founders for investor conversations.
Time Efficiency: Respects busy schedules with under 90 minutes of content. High signal-to-noise ratio throughout.
Honest Limitations
Limited Depth: Financial section stays at a high level. Lacks detailed modeling or cash flow analysis for complex scenarios.
No Templates: Misses opportunity to provide scorecards or hiring rubrics. Learners must build tools independently.
Few Examples: Could benefit from real company case studies. Abstract concepts need more grounding in practice.
Narrow Scope: Focuses on early scaling only. Doesn't address post-Series A or public company challenges.
